WebOne another is preferred when we are making general statements. We see each other / one another every day. (= Each of us sees the other every day.) They can sit for hours without talking to each other / one another. Note that each other and one another are not usually used as subjects in a clause. WebUsage. ‘Each other’ and ‘one another’ are called reciprocal pronouns and are used as such. In other words, these types of pronouns are used to indicate that two or more people have carried out some type of action, where all parties involved received the consequences or benefits of that action. ‘Each other’ is less formal, and is ... WebEach other vs. one another. Some English usage authorities urge the use of each other when referring to two people and one another for more than two people. Yet there’s no logical reason for this guideline, and writers break it nearly as often as they follow it. WebA. Dan and I waved hello to each other. B. The students talked to one another. A. WebAug 31, 2024 · Each of vs. every one of. If each and every are being used before a plural noun, you need to include the word of after them. That’s when the phrases each of and every one of come in handy. For example: She gave each of them assignments that day. The teacher graded every one of the tests. Using each other for a trio would mean that only one person has a connection … dix hills ice rink public skateWebEach other and one another are usually the direct or indirect object of a verb. We help each other a lot. They sent one another gifts from time to time. You can also use them as the object of a preposition. Pierre and Thierry were jealous of each other.
